Hi! Do some of you guys have a spare 1970-72 mirror mounting base ( the one you bolts to the door and then you mount the mirror on it with a single screw) and the black plastic gasket? It's for a RH side mirror, but I think it's the same from the LH side. The mirror is the "Tri Shield" for my 1970 GS Stage1. Thanks in advance! Regards - Hans
The mounting base will not be the same right to left side - screw hole to mount the mirror to the base would have the opposite orientation.
Me thinks the base is the same "side to side"....same idea as fender emblems. Just do a "180" with one and will work either side. Holes for mounting base to door are exactly the same spacing.
If you take the left base and put it on the right, the tang where the screw goes in to hold the mirror in place would be facing in on the right side. Unless you want your right mirror ponting inward, it will not work.
Politely disagree. If you have a left hand base and gasket all you need to do is trim the "guide pin" from the gasket and everything works on the right side.
I have this gasket, with the bracket and the three screws. The bracket for the chrome mirror carries the same part number, unlike the sport mirrors, which do have a specified left and right position. Matt
